Output 8dd5ddad1006918696c1ed2922e9bef003a1ad0067cd41f3fd15605c8ac4ec17:0

value
2779205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24fb86ca6f51616cd2ff758c32f2b078818b1342 OP_EQUAL
address
354ZZpTf24tkcgaTrghxgzKg6oGy7x12K2
transaction
8dd5ddad1006918696c1ed2922e9bef003a1ad0067cd41f3fd15605c8ac4ec17
confirmations
345058
spent
true